In Vladivostok, there are many historical monuments, which will be interesting to see for all the guests of the city. One of them is the Primorsky State Joint Museum named after V.K. Arsenyev. This is one of the oldest museums in Primorsky Krai, which was founded in 1884 and occupies a beautiful building in the center of the city. Within the walls of the museum there are ethnographic and archaeological expositions, a rich ornithological exhibition, a geological exposition, extensive collections of art objects and a series of mobile temporary exhibitions.
